ASTM A369 Grade FP91 vs. ACI-ASTM CF8M Steel

Both ASTM A369 grade FP91 and ACI-ASTM CF8M steel are iron alloys. They have 76%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 31 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(2,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is ASTM A369 grade FP91 and the bottom bar is ACI-ASTM CF8M steel.
